Table of Contents

Introduction.- Hydrologic analysis of Tangjiashan barrier lake area.- Geological characteristics of Tangjiashan barrier lake area.- Outburst flood evolution analysis of Tangjiashan barrier lake.- Study on the anti-impact stability of discontinuous wide graded mixture of weir body.- Study on the emergency danger elimination plan of Tangjiashan barrier lake.- Construction of Tangjiashan barrier lake emergency danger elimination project.- Emergency monitoring and assurance system.- Evaluation of the discharge process of lake water and the effect of risk removal.

Author Information

Qigui Yang is “National Engineering Survey and Design Master”, professorate senior engineer, doctoral supervisor, currently is chairman of the board of CISPDR Corporation, “Young and Middle-aged Expert with Outstanding National Contributions”, and the winner of the First National Innovation Competition Award. He has long been engaged in the design of embankment dam and geotechnical engineering, risk assessment and research of emergency rescue technology of barrier lake. He proposed risk assessment methods of barrier lake and built a technical system of emergency response, which fills the gap in barrier lake emergency response technology at home and abroad. He is responsible for or participate in more than 30 national research projects and engineering research projects. He successfully removed the risk of the Tangjiashan barrier lake, which was praised by the General Command of the State Council for earthquake relief as ""a miracle of handling large barrier lakes in the world"". He has been crowned the National Award for Science and Technology twice (ranked 1st and 2nd), honored with 2 Provincial and Ministerial Science and Technology Progress Special Awards (all ranked 1st), 5 first Awards;1 National Excellent Engineering Survey and Design Gold Award, 2 Silver Award. He is the holder of 25 Chinese Invention patents (12 items ranked 1st), 14 International Invention patents (6 items ranked 1st), and wrote 7 technical standards (2 items ranked 1st). He is also the author/coauthor of more than 80 research papers, and the first author of 5 books. Wenjun Yang is a professorate senior engineer and doctoral supervisor. He is currently the vice president of the Changjiang River Scientific Research Institute and an expert enjoying special government subsidies from the State Council. He is national level candidate for the ""The New Century Talents Project"" and the first ministerial level candidate for the ""5151 Talents Project"" of the Ministry of Water Resources. He won the Outstanding Youth Award of the Chinese Hydraulic Engineering Society and the First Zhang Guangdou Outstanding Youth Award. He has been long engaged in technical research on hydraulics and river dynamics, water environment and ecological water conservancy, and water and sediment measurement technology. He presided 2 scientific and technological support projects during the 11th Five-Year Plan, and was responsible for one National Key Research and Development Project during the 13th Five-Year Plan, three science and technology projects such as major scientific research instrument development projects and general program of the National Natural Science Foundation of China. He has been crowned the National Science and Technology Progress Award three times, and awarded the National Engineering Design Gold Prize, 7 Provincial and Ministerial Science and Technology Progress First and Special Prizes. He is the first author of 4 books, the co-author of 3 technical standards. He is also the holder of more than 20 invention patents, and the author/coauthor of more than 100 research papers.
